How to Make Baked Cod with Mayo and Parmesan
Making this dish is straightforward and rewarding. Let’s walk through the preparation, mixing, cooking, and finishing steps to create a satisfying meal.
Ingredients:
- 4 cod fillets (about 6 ounces each)
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
- Lemon slices (for serving)
Directions:
Step 1: Preparation
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Rinse the cod fillets under cold water and pat them dry with paper towels. This will help the seasoning adhere better.
Step 2: Mixing
In a medium bowl, combine the mayonnaise, grated Parmesan cheese,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and black pepper. Mix until well blended to create a creamy topping that will infuse the fish with flavor.
Step 3: Cooking
Place the dried cod fillets in a lightly greased baking dish. Spread the mayonnaise mixture evenly over the top of each cod fillet, ensuring they are completely covered. Bake the cod in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es, or until the fish flakes easily with a fork and the topping is golden brown.
Step 4: Finishing
Once cooked, remove the dish from the oven and let it rest for about 5 minutes. Garnish the baked cod with chopped fresh parsley and serve with lemon slices on the side for an added burst of freshness.
How to Serve Baked Cod with Mayo and Parmesan
Baked Cod with Mayo and Parmesan pairs beautifully with a variety of sides. Consider serving it alongside steamed vegetables, a light salad, or rice to soak up the delicious sauce. A crisp white wine would be a perfect accompaniment to enhance your dining experience.
How to Store Baked Cod with Mayo and Parmesan
If you have leftovers, allow the cod to cool completely before storing. Place it in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 2 days. To reheat, place it in an oven preheated to 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es, or until heated through.
Expert Tips for Perfect Baked Cod with Mayo and Parmesan
- For added flavor, consider mixing in herbs or spices of your choice into the mayonnaise mixture, such as dill or paprika.
- If you prefer a crispy topping, broil the fillets for the last 2-3 minutes of cooking.
- Feel free to substitute cod with other white fish like haddock or tilapia, which could also work well in this recipe.
Delicious Variations
- Herbed Cod: Add fresh herbs like dill, parsley, or chives to the mayonnaise mixture for a fresh twist.
- Spicy Version: Mix in some hot sauce or cayenne pepper into the mayonnaise blend for a kick.
- Cheesy Delight: Change up the cheese by mixing in shredded cheddar or a mix of Italian cheeses with the Parmesan for a different flavor profile.
Frequently Asked Questions
-
Can I use frozen cod for this recipe?
Yes, you can use frozen cod. Just make sure to thaw it completely and pat it dry before preparing. -
What should I do if I don’t have Dijon mustard?
You can substitute Dijon mustard with yellow mustard or even omit it for a milder flavor. -
How can I tell when cod is perfectly cooked?
Cod is done when it flakes easily with a fork and is opaque throughout. An internal temperature of 145°F (63°C) is ideal. -
Can I make this dish 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the cod and topping in advance and store them separately in the refrigerator. Assemble and bake when you’re ready to serve. -
What other sides go well with baked cod?
Baked cod pairs well with mashed potatoes, quinoa, or a fresh green salad for a balanced meal.
